sistema de archivos y particiones

9
UNIVERSIDAD MARIANO GÁLVEZ CENTRO REGIONAL HUEHUETENANGO INGENIERÍA EN SISTEMAS Sistemas Operativos Abiertos Ing. Heber Martínez Alfaro PARTICIONES DE DISCO DURO Y FORMATO DE ARCHIVOS Emmanuel Edadier Villanueva Mérida

Upload: jesus-castaneda

Post on 20-Nov-2015

6 views

Category:

Documents


1 download

DESCRIPTION

definicion de los formatos de archivos que puede contener una particion y las diferentes particiones

TRANSCRIPT

UNIVERSIDAD MARIANO GLVEZCENTRO REGIONAL HUEHUETENANGO

INGENIERA EN SISTEMASSistemas Operativos AbiertosIng. Heber Martnez Alfaro

PARTICIONES DE DISCO DURO Y FORMATO DE ARCHIVOS

Emmanuel Edadier Villanueva Mrida4490-12-17781

Huehuetenango, 27 de marzo 2012

INTRODUCCION

Una particin de un disco duro es una divisin lgica en una unidad de almacenamiento (por ejemplo un disco duro o unidad flash), en la cual se alojan y organizan los archivos mediante un sistema de archivos. Existen distintos esquemas de particiones para la distribucin de particiones en un disco.

Para poder contener datos, las particiones tienen que poseer un sistema de archivos. El espacio no asignado en un disco no es una particin, por lo que no puede tener un sistema de archivos. Existen mltiples sistemas de archivos con diferentes capacidades como: FAT, NTFS, FAT32, EXT2, EXT3, EXT4, Btrfs, FedFS, ReiserFS, Reiser4 u otros.

Es comn que en los sistemas basados o similares a UNIX generalmente se usan hasta con 3 particiones: la principal, montada en el directorio raz (/); a veces hay tambin una segunda que se usa para montar el directorio /home, el cual contiene las configuraciones de los usuarios, y finalmente, una tercera llamada swap, que se usa para la memoria virtual temporal. Sin embargo, 2 particiones (/, y swap) es el mnimo suficiente en estos sistemas operativos. Cabe decir adems que las particiones de intercambio (swap) pueden instalarse sin problemas dentro de una particin lgica. A las particiones de intercambio, al igual que a la memoria RAM, no se les asigna un directorio; este tipo de particiones se usa para guardar ciertas rplicas de la memoria RAM, para que de esta forma la RAM tenga ms espacio para las tareas en primer plano, guardando las tareas en segundo plano dentro de la particin de intercambio.

PARTICIONES DE DISCO

SWAP:Un archivo de swap es un archivo comn, y no necesita ningn tratamiento especial para el kernel. Lo nico que le interesa al kernel es que este no tenga huecos y que est preparado para ser utilizado por el utilitariomkswap. Este debe residir en un disco local, y no puede residir en un disco montado a travs de NFS por razones de implementacin.

El bit que indica espacios vacos es importante. El archivo swap reserva espacio en disco de forma que el kernel pueda swapear una pgina rpidamente sin tener que atravesar por todas las cosas que son necesarias cuando aloca un sector de disco para un archivo. El kernel simplemente utiliza cualquier sector que ya haya sido alocado para el archivo. Debido a que un hueco en un archivo significa que no hay sectores de discos alocados (para ubicar en ese archivo) no es bueno que el kernel trate de hacer uso del mismo.

PARTICION /boot:Contiene el kernel del sistema operativo (el cual permite a su sistema arrancar Red Hat Enterprise Linux) junto con archivos utilizados durante el proceso de arranque. Para la mayora de los usuarios, una particin de arranque de 250 MB es suficiente

PARTICION /raiz O /root: Aqu es donde se localiza "/" (el directorio raz). En esta configuracin, todos los archivos (excepto aquellos almacenados en /boot) estn en la particin raz.

3.0 GB le permite instalar una instalacin mnima, mientras que una particin raz de 5.0 GB le permite realizar una instalacin completa, seleccionando todos los grupos de paquetes

La particin / (o raz) Es la cima de la estructura del directorio. El directorio /root (algunas veces pronunciado "slash-root") es el directorio principal de la cuenta del usuario-administrador del sistema.

Particin del sistema EFI ( ESP ) es una particin en un dispositivo de almacenamiento de datos que es utilizado por las computadoras que se adhieren a la Unified Extensible Firmware Interface (UEFI). Cuando un equipo est encendido y arranque , carga archivos de firmware UEFI almacenados en el ESP para iniciar instalados sistemas operativos y varias utilidades. Una particin ESP necesita ser formateada con uno de los sistemas de archivos FAT variantes.

ESP contiene los boot loader programas para todos los sistemas operativos instalados (que figuran en otras particiones en el mismo u otro dispositivo de almacenamiento), archivos de controladores de dispositivos para los dispositivos presentes en un equipo que utiliza el firmware en el arranque, programas de utilidades del sistema que estn destinadas a ejecutarse antes de que un sistema operativo se carga, y los archivos de datos, como registros de errores.

Sistemas de archivos

Los sistemas de ficheros son uno de los principales componentes de un sistema operativo y de ellos se espera que sean rpidos y extremadamente fiables. Sin embargo a veces ocurren fallos imprevistos y las mquinas se caen inesperadamente bien por fallos hardware, por fallos software o por fallos elctricos.

FAT32:Es un sistema de archivos que funciona prcticamente con cualquier sistema operativo pero que fue creado por MS-DOS. El FAT32 es el sucesor delFAT16. El tamao mximo de este sistema de archivos es de de 4 gigabytes menos 1 byte. Se utiliza como mecanismo de intercambio de datos entre sistemas operativos distintos de un mismo PC, llamado como entorno multiarranque. Tambin se utiliza en tarjetas de memoria y dispositivos similares. El FAT32 carece de permisos de seguridad: cualquier usuario puede acceder a cualquier archivo.

NTFS(New Technology File System):Es un sistema de archivos de Windows. Permite definir el tamao del clster, a partir de 512 bytes sin importar eltamao de la particin. El tamao mnimo recomendado para la particin es de 10 GB. Aunque son posibles tamaos mayores, el mximo recomendado en la prctica para cada volumen es de 2 Terabytes. NTFS fue creado para lograr un sistema de archivos eficiente y seguro y est basado en el sistema de archivos HPFS de IBM/Microsoft usado en el sistema operativo OS/2. Sin embargo, tambin tiene caractersticas del filesystem HFS diseado por Apple.

Comparacin entre los sistemas de archivos FAT32 y NTFS:Al ser NTFS ms nuevo y, se dice que es el sucesor de FAT32, tiene mejores caractersticas. El FAT32 no tiene cifrado de archivos como s lo tiene el NTFS. La forma de almacenamiento tiene una estructura de datos compleja que acelera el acceso a los ficheros y reduce lafragmentacin. Esta caracterstica era ms criticada del sistema FAT32. Los sistemas que emplean NTFS tienen una estabilidad mejor que los sistemas FAT. El sistema de archivos NTFS posee un funcionamiento prcticamente secreto, ya que Microsoft no ha liberado su cdigo y al contrario ya lo hizo con FAT. El sistema NTFS permite el uso de nombres extensos, aunque, a diferencia del sistema FAT32, distingue entre maysculas y minsculas.

Ext3(third extended file system):Es un sistema de archivos conregistro por diario, principalmente utilizado endistribuciones Linux.En la actualidad est siendo remplazado por su sucesor, ext4. Ext3 es una versin mejorada del sistema de archivos ext2. Ext3 utiliza un rbol binario balanceado e incorpora el asignador de bloques dedisco Orlov. Con el sistema de archivos ext3 se obtiene una gran reduccin del tiempo necesario para recuperar un sistema de ficheros despus de una cada. El principal objetivo del ext3 es por tanto la disponibilidad. Con esto nos referimos a cuando se apague incorrectamente la mquina tener el sistema totalmente disponible al momento despus de volver a arrancar sin necesidad de que se tenga que esperar a pasar un fsck, el cual tarda mucho tiempo

Ext4(fourth extended file system) :Se trata de unamejora compatible de ext3. es ms rpido que ext3 salvo a la hora de eliminar archivos. En comparacin a los otros sistemas de archivo es ms rpido pero no con tanta diferencia. Incluye una nueva forma de evitar la fragmentacin de archivos. Usa una tcnica conocida como Extents que ayuda a asegurar que los archivos se escriban en forma contigua. Este tipo de sistema de archivos soporta hasta 1ExaByte(=1048576 TeraBytes), la cual hasta da de hoy no es posible llenar. Una de las desventajas de este tipo de sistemas de archivos es que consumen mucha CPU, por lo tanto en equipos muy antiguos lo que se gana en rapidez de acceso al disco se pierde en uso de CPU. Hasta el da de hoy no hay pruebas que muestren si la CPU va a sufrir la rapidez de ext4.

CONCLUSIONES

Algunos sistemas de archivos tienen tamaos mximos ms pequeos que los que el tamao que proporciona un disco, siendo necesaria una particin de tamao pequeo, para que sea posible el adecuado funcionamiento de este antiguo sistema de archivos.

En algunos sistemas operativos aconsejan ms de una particin para funcionar, como por ejemplo, la particin de intercambio (swap) en los sistemas operativos basados en Linux.

Las particiones extendidas se inventaron para superar el lmite de 4 particiones primarias mximas por cada disco duro y poder crear un nmero ilimitado de unidades lgicas, cada una con un sistema de archivos diferente de la otra.

RECOMENDACIONES

Manejar el formato de archivos dependiendo de la informacin que se vaya a guardar en la particin.

Segn el sistema operativo se debern crear las particiones y los tipos de formatos que se necesitan, teniendo un previo conocimiento.

En cada particin extendida se debe agregar el tipo correcto de archivos para evitar problamas de compatibilidad.

E-GRAFIA http://lsi.ugr.es/jagomez/disisoparchivos/trabajosDSO/Presenta2/Ext3vsExt4.pdf https://andalinux.wordpress.com/2013/06/12/espacio-ocupado-por-distintos-sistemas-de-archivos-ext3ext4fat32ntfs/ http://es.wikipedia.org/wiki/Partici%C3%B3n_de_disco http://web.mit.edu/rhel-doc/4/RH-DOCS/rhel-ig-x8664-multi-es-4/s1-diskpartitioning.html